XPO Jobs Information

Do workers at XPO get paid breaks?

Sometimes. Only some people get paid breaks.
63% of people say they don’t get paid breaks.
Based on data from 60 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between August 2025 and August 2026.

Does XPO pay people when they’re sick?

Sometimes. Only some people get paid when they’re sick.
46% of people say they wouldn’t get paid if they were sick but scheduled to work.
Based on data from 90 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between August 2025 and August 2026.

At XPO, are sick days and vacation days separate paid time off?

Sick days and vacation days are used from the same paid time off.
92% of people say they have to use vacation days when they’re out sick.
Based on data from 96 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between August 2025 and August 2026.

Is it stressful to work at XPO?

Most people feel stressed out here.
78% of people say they often feel stressed out at work.
Based on data from 98 people who took the Breakroom Quiz between August 2025 and August 2026.

    Company Overview: Established in California in 2013, Green Water and Power has rapidly grown to operate in over 25 states, positioning itself as a leader in the sustainable energy sector. Named the #1 electric vehicle (EV) installer in America, we take pride in having deployed more than 11,000 EV chargers and completed approximately 5 megawatts (MW) of solar energy projects.
    As an EVITP (Electric Vehicle Infrastructure Training Program) certified turnkey eng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) firm, we leverage our in-house expertise to efficiently manage and execute large-scale projects. Our dedication to sustainability and quality extends beyond project completion; we also provide comprehensive operation and maintenance services to ensure optimal performance for the projects we develop, as well as for third-party installations.
    Position Overview: Green Water and Power is looking for a Warehouse Assistant to join our team. The Warehouse Assistant ensures smooth operational flow by handling inventory, preparing shipments, and maintaining warehouse organization. This individual will also manage the logistics between the warehouse and construction sites, safely transporting materials, tools, and equipment. This role requires physical stamina, attention to detail, and proficiency in, or ability to learn, inventory software and material handling equipment.
    Duties and Responsibilities:
    Warehouse Operations
    • Assist with receiving, unpacking, and organizing incoming shipments of EV charging equipment, parts, and supplies.
    • Prepare outgoing shipments by picking, packing, and labeling items accurately and efficiently.
    • Maintain an organized and tidy warehouse space, including shelving, storage bins, and work areas.
    • Sign in/sign out existing tools in inventory/management of inventory and issuing POs, to track the tools, make and manage tool kits for each employee.
    • Perform inventory counts and stock checks to ensure accuracy and proper stock levels, reporting any discrepancies to the Procurement Manager.
    • Assist in conducting periodic inventory audits and reconciliations as directed.
    • Collaborate with crews to fulfill orders and prepare them for shipment in a timely manner.
    • Send emails to one contact for dashboard, not just packing but creating shipments on platforms such as Xpo and FedEx.
    • Order breakers, panels, internet equipment, etc.
    • Operate material handling equipment such as forklifts and pallet jacks, safely and efficiently.
    • Follow all safety procedures and guidelines while handling and storing materials.
    • Tour jobsites/warehouses for our own personal knowledge/benefit of the company.
    • Delivery of recycling items or tools to be calibrated.
    • Office security (as well as opening and closing).
    • Monitor jobsite chats research electric utility afl or online source for series ratings at site.
    • Fleet vehicle maintenance (washes, auto/body repair, oil changes, etc.), stickers, alert GWP office staff for vehicle reassignment for insurance purposes.
    • Support other departments as needed with tasks such as light assembly, packaging, or general maintenance.

    Driving and Delivery Duties
    • Safely operate company vehicles to transport materials, tools, and equipment to job sites, suppliers, and client locations as directed.
    • Pick up and deliver shipments, returns, and supplies from vendors or project locations in a timely and professional manner.
    • Ensure all transported materials are properly secured and protected during transit to prevent damage or loss.
    • Perform daily vehicle inspections, checking for fluid levels, tire condition, lights, and overall safety; promptly report any maintenance or repair needs.
    • Maintain accurate delivery logs, mileage reports, and receipts in accordance with company policies.
    • Adhere to all state and federal traffic laws, as well as company driving policies and safety standards.
    • Represent Green Water and Power professionally while driving and interacting with vendors, clients, and site personnel.
    • Assist in loading and unloading vehicles, ensuring materials are organized and handled carefully.
    • Maintain cleanliness and orderliness of the assigned vehicle, ensuring it is stocked with necessary delivery materials.
    • Drive company vehicles to local stores or suppliers as needed to pick up supplies or materials required for warehouse or project operations.

    Qualifications:
    • High school diploma or equivalent.
    • Valid Driver's License.
    • Previous experience in a warehouse or similar environment preferred but not required; training will be provided.
    • Basic math skills and the ability to accurately count, measure, and record inventory.
    • Physical ability to lift and move heavy objects (up to 50 pounds) and perform tasks requiring bending, stooping, and reaching.
    • Strong attention to detail and organizational skills.
    • Ability to work effectively both independently and as part of a team.
    • Willingness to learn and adapt to new tasks and procedures.
    • Forklift certification (or willingness to obtain certification) is a plus.
